A critical security vulnerability, identified as CVE-2025-49674, has been discovered in the Windows Routing and Remote Access Service (RRAS). This flaw is a heap-based buffer overflow that allows unauthorized attackers to execute arbitrary code over a network, posing significant risks to affected systems.
Heap-based buffer overflows occur when a program writes more data to a buffer located in the heap than it can hold, leading to adjacent memory corruption. In the context of RRAS, this vulnerability can be exploited by sending specially crafted packets that overflow the buffer, enabling attackers to execute malicious code remotely. This type of vulnerability is particularly dangerous because it can lead to complete system compromise without requiring physical access.

The CVE-2025-49674 vulnerability affects multiple versions of Windows operating systems that utilize RRAS. The Common Vulnerability Scoring System (CVSS) has assigned this flaw a base score of 8.8, categorizing it as high severity. The attack vector is network-based, with low attack complexity and no user interaction required, making it relatively easy for attackers to exploit. The impact includes high confidentiality, integrity, and availability impacts, indicating that successful exploitation could lead to significant data breaches and system disruptions.Potential Impact
Exploitation of this vulnerability could allow attackers to:- Execute Arbitrary Code: Run malicious programs or commands on the affected system.
- Gain Unauthorized Access: Obtain elevated privileges, potentially leading to full control over the system.
- Disrupt Services: Cause denial-of-service conditions by crashing or destabilizing the RRAS.
Mitigation Strategies
To protect systems from this vulnerability, administrators should:- Apply Security Patches: Microsoft has released patches addressing this issue. Ensure all affected systems are updated with the latest security updates.
- Disable Unnecessary Services: If RRAS is not in use, consider disabling it to reduce the attack surface.
- Implement Network Segmentation: Restrict access to RRAS to trusted networks and users only.
- Monitor Network Traffic: Use intrusion detection systems to identify and respond to suspicious activities targeting RRAS.
